IP Address & Network Connection FAQs

What is an IP Address? An Internet Protocol (IP) address is a unique numerical label assigned to each device connected to a computer network that uses the Internet for communication.
What is the difference between IPv4 and IPv6? IPv4 uses a 32-bit address format (e.g., 192.168.1.1), while IPv6 uses a 128-bit hex format to accommodate the billions of devices now connected to the internet.
How accurate is the IP-based location? IP geolocation is generally accurate at the city or region level, but it cannot pinpoint a precise street address for privacy and technical reasons.
Does OTechy store my IP address? No. This tool is designed for real-time lookup. Your IP address is displayed to you and processed momentarily to fetch location data, but it is never stored in our database.
What is a Public vs. Private IP? A Public IP is what the world sees when you browse the web, while a Private IP is used only within your local home or office Wi-Fi network.
Why does my IP address change? Most ISPs assign "Dynamic IP" addresses that change periodically. If you need a permanent one, you would typically need a "Static IP" plan from your provider.
Can someone find my house using my IP? Generally, no. An IP address only reveals the ISP's exchange location. Only law enforcement with a legal warrant can request a specific physical address from your ISP.
What is a VPN and how does it affect my IP? A Virtual Private Network (VPN) masks your real IP by routing your traffic through a server in another location, making it appear as if you are browsing from there.
What is an ISP? ISP stands for Internet Service Provider. This is the company (like Jio, Airtel, or BSNL) that provides you with internet access and assigns your IP address.
Why is my location showing a different city? Your IP often reflects the location of your ISP's nearest data center or "gateway" rather than your exact physical doorstep.
How can I hide my IP address? You can hide your IP address by using a VPN, a Proxy server, or the Tor browser to increase your online anonymity.
Is it safe to share my IP address? While an IP alone isn't a direct threat, it's best not to share it publicly, as it can be used for targeted DDoS attacks or to track your general online activity.
